| Dak Lak people take pictures during the coffee flower season. Dak Lak Province in the Central Highlands of Vietnam is called the “capital” of Vietnamese coffee because there are boundless green coffee fields on the local basaltic hills which are always full of wind and sunshine. The area is known for many coffee brands, which are not only famous at home but also exported to more than 80 countries and territories throughout the world. (Photo: VN Express) |
![]() |
| Coffee flower blooms mainly from the end of February to the end of April, divided into several times. Each time lasts from 7 to 10 days. Flowers grow most in the provinces of Pleiku, Buon Ma Thuat, Dak Lak ... (Photo: VN Express) |

| This flower grows in clusters along the stem and branches. Each branch usually has 5-10 flowers adjacent to each other. The petals are thin, round, with white stamens interwoven, resembling chrysanthemums. In the coffee flower season in the middle of the early spring, in the cold weather of the Central Highlands, bees come to find honey. Nguyen thinks that flowers bloom best in the first wave. Besides, depending on soil, water volume, the weather of each region, flowers will bloom in about 1-2 weeks after Tet. Coffee flowers carry a fragrant scent. (Photo: VN Express) |
